How Does the UN Choose These Days?

The United Nations General Assembly creates most international days. However, specialized agencies often suggest them as well. Specifically, UNESCO handles cultural days while the WHO manages health events. Therefore, these dates are not just symbols. Instead, they help the world reach the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s).

Popular Observances in 2026 and 2027

Many days attract huge interest every year. For example, our list features:

  • International Women’s Day (March 8): Primarily, this day focuses on equality.
  • Earth Day (April 22): Similarly, millions act to save the planet on this date.
  • World Mental Health Day (October 10): Thus, we talk about well-being globally.
  • Human Rights Day (December 10): Indeed, this marks a famous UN declaration.
